What is CVE-2022-31890?

A SQL Injection vulnerability exists in the osTicket plugins' audit functionality, specifically in the order parameter passed to the getOrder function. This flaw allows an attacker to manipulate SQL queries, potentially leading to unauthorized data access and alteration. Users of osTicket plugins should apply necessary patches to prevent exploitation and ensure the security of their systems.
